St Vincent Anderson Regional Hospital Anderson Center is an addiction treatment center located at 2210 Jackson Street in the 46016 zip code in Anderson, IN.
It is operated by a private non-profit organization. St Vincent Anderson Regional Hospital Anderson Center provides prescribes suboxone, relapse prevention from naltrexone and naltrexone administration. Some of the treatment approaches used by St Vincent Anderson Regional Hospital Anderson Center include 12-step rehab, motivational interviewing and brief intervention services. St Vincent Anderson Regional Hospital Anderson Center also specializes in detox services and offers residential benzodiazepines detox, inpatient cocaine detoxification and in-patient methamphetamines detoxification. St Vincent Anderson Regional Hospital Anderson Center provides inpatient hospital addiction treatment, residential heroin rehab and outpatient heroin services. It also provides supervised heroin detox, residential treatment for heroin abuse and inpatient dual diagnosis treatment. Other addiction treatment offered includes general addiction disorder treatment and treatment for gambling disorder.
